On Sun, Jan 11, 2015 at 07:24:54PM +0100, Rickard Strandqvist wrote:
> Remove the function objio_alloc_deviceid_node() that is not used anywhere.
> 
> This was partially found by using a static code analysis program called cppcheck.

It needs to be wire up, just like the alloc_deviceid_node instances in
other layout drivers.  I'll send a proper fix.
